What Is Sweet Gourmand-Floral?
Gourmand fragrances borrow from the dessert table — vanilla, sugar, caramel and toasted notes that smell good enough to eat. The best ones stay warm and skin-like instead of tipping into syrup, and the oil format keeps that sweetness intimate rather than loud.
How To Get 8–12 Hours Out Of It
Because there’s no alcohol to flash off, a single pass is usually plenty. Start light, give it ten minutes to bloom, and add a touch more only if you want a bigger trail.
